Learning Outcomes
|
By the end of this course the student will be able to:
- Use and exploitation of aggregate materials.
- Ability of drawing up mineralopetrographic and physicomechanical study of rocks.
- Management of dangerous quarry wastes and delimination of new possible areas.
- Maintenance and restoration of ancient monuments.

| Syllabus |
- Marbles and ornamental rocks- physical features, physicomechanical properties of marbles- allocation and varieties of marbles- applications of rocks- the marble in ancienty and in nowdays- databases.
- Aggregate materials and rocks- mineralopetrographic examination, laboratory tests and classification of aggregates for their different uses. – existing legislative framework and environmental restoration.
